The Nexperia 74LVC1G17GW-Q100,1 is a single non-inverting Schmitt-trigger buffer from the 74LVC family, supplied in a 5-pin TSSOP surface-mount package. It operates from a wide 1.65 V to 5.5 V supply and provides hysteresis on its input to clean up slow or noisy signals. The device offers a fast 7 ns propagation delay with very low 100 nA quiescent current, and is rated over -40 to 125 C. It is RoHS compliant and supplied on tape and reel.
The 74LVC1G17GW-Q100,1 is used to buffer and reshape digital signals, converting slow, noisy, or slowly rising inputs into clean, fast logic transitions thanks to its Schmitt-trigger hysteresis. Typical applications include signal conditioning, line buffering, and debouncing across a wide supply range.
